## Changelog — Font vendoring defaults changed

As of this release, the Bracken UI build no longer fetches third-party fonts at build time. All typefaces used by the Lanternwell suite are now vendored into the repo under a dedicated assets directory, and the fetch step is skipped by default. If you're onboarding, nothing to install — the fonts travel with the checkout. The build flags controlling this behavior are listed below.

settings of hadup-yafog:
LAMAEL_PIN=3761
LAMAEL_TENANT=istmir
LAMAEL_METRICS_HOST=metrics.lamael.plorvasys.test
LAMAEL_SEAL=seal_8ea68500
LAMAEL_STANDBY_TEAM=fraok

**Break-glass access — Murrow Hall audio guide**

If the Echolane audio-guide backend goes down during open hours, break-glass access lets you restart narration streams without the usual approval chain. Use it only when visitor-facing tours are failing. Log the incident afterward in the maintainers' channel. The break-glass console sits behind a sealed credential store; to open it, supply the recovery passphrase recorded immediately below.

unlock words, yawig-kagef: gordor-holvan-ulaael-pramir-ulaiel-tamdor

TURN-208: Gatevale turnstile counters at the Merrow Field pilot double-count when a rotation reverses mid-cycle. Attendance totals drift roughly 2% high per event. The debounce window fix is implemented, reviewed by Ilsa, and soak-tested across two simulated match days without drift. Ready for your cut; the candidate build is identified below.

trace token, tagag-tafog: htk6_5ed18c

## Onboarding: Fareweight Rules Engine

Fareweight computes shipping fees from stacked rule sets. Rules are versioned; never edit a live version. Deploys go through the staging evaluator first. Read the rule DSL guide before touching anything.

Rule definitions live in the pricing database — connect to it with the connection string below.

primary connection of yagep-bajop = postgresql://druiel_svc:gW@db-3860.sivrelworks.example:5432/brieth